I have a HP G6 245 notebook. Its battery is dead (capacity down from 40k mWh to 5k). A replacement on the HP website is out of stock.
Browsed online retailers and all mention battery in the range of 1-2k. I don't have faith in buying from them. So I visited HP World physical store today who quoted 4.2k for a replacement with 1-year warranty (T&C applied wrt recharge cycles).
My question is: is it worth buying it at that price or are there better alternatives that I don't know about?

Your HP 245 G6 Notebook PC according to: http://h10032.www1.hp.com/ctg/Manual/c05485597.pdf, requires one of two batteries: an HP 3-cell battery, 31 Whr Li-ion with HP p/n: 919700-850, can be purchased here: https://search.rakuten.co.jp/search/mall/HP+919700-850/, or an HP 4-cell battery, 41 Whr Li-ion with HP p/n: 919701-850 (recommended), which can be purchased here: https://search.rakuten.co.jp/search/mall/HP+919701-850/.
